Little Teeth, Big Smiles, Tiny Chompers, Baby Grins

Tiny teeth may be cute, but they need big care. Even though your little one isn't snacking much yet, it's important to introduce good oral habits early on. This helps stop upcoming problems and gives them a healthy smile for life! Start by gently wiping their gums with a soft washcloth. As those teeth come in, you can use a miniature toothbrush and safe for babies toothpaste. Don't overlook regular visits with the dentist, too!

Safeguarding Your Child's Pearly Whites

Keeping your little one's smiles healthy is a crucial part of their overall well-being. Starting with healthy oral hygiene habits early can set the stage for a lifetime of happy smiles. Establish a routine that incorporates brushing twice a morning and night, using a child-friendly toothbrush and a children's toothpaste. Don't overlook to take your child to the dentist for cleanings at least every six months.
